  • The best advertisement I've ever created. When working at Cronin&Co., me and my partner Bob visited the hospital to be inspired so we could come up with a concept that would motivate people to donate money to children's' cancer. Someone at the hospital told us this true story, and there came the concept. We did not invent it, we simply re-told a story of tough men with a gentle and giving heart in moving pictures. Creating this spot is one of my proudest achievements. It is in the MoMA's permanent collection. Thanks to the children, the ironworkers the production company and its director for helping us Madison Avenue advertisers do something great. Don Draper would be proud.
